#include "quiche/quic/moqt/moqt_names.h"
#include <iterator>
#include <string>
#include <vector>
#include "absl/strings/escaping.h"
#include "absl/strings/str_cat.h"
#include "absl/strings/str_join.h"
#include "absl/strings/string_view.h"
#include "absl/types/span.h"
#include "quiche/common/platform/api/quiche_bug_tracker.h"
namespace moqt {
TrackNamespace::TrackNamespace(absl::Span<const absl::string_view> elements)
: tuple_(elements.begin(), elements.end()) {
if (std::size(elements) > kMaxNamespaceElements) {
tuple_.clear();
QUICHE_BUG(Moqt_namespace_too_large_01)
<< "Constructing a namespace that is too large.";
return;
}
for (auto it : elements) {
length_ += it.size();
if (length_ > kMaxFullTrackNameSize) {
tuple_.clear();
QUICHE_BUG(Moqt_namespace_too_large_02)
<< "Constructing a namespace that is too large.";
return;
}
}
}
bool TrackNamespace::InNamespace(const TrackNamespace& other) const {
if (tuple_.size() < other.tuple_.size()) {
return false;
}
for (int i = 0; i < other.tuple_.size(); ++i) {
if (tuple_[i] != other.tuple_[i]) {
return false;
}
}
return true;
}
void TrackNamespace::AddElement(absl::string_view element) {
if (!CanAddElement(element)) {
QUICHE_BUG(Moqt_namespace_too_large_03)
<< "Constructing a namespace that is too large.";
return;
}
length_ += element.length();
tuple_.push_back(std::string(element));
}
std::string TrackNamespace::ToString() const {
std::vector<std::string> bits;
bits.reserve(tuple_.size());
for (absl::string_view raw_bit : tuple_) {
bits.push_back(absl::StrCat("\"", absl::CHexEscape(raw_bit), "\""));
}
return absl::StrCat("{", absl::StrJoin(bits, "::"), "}");
}
FullTrackName::FullTrackName(absl::string_view ns, absl::string_view name)
: namespace_(ns), name_(name) {
QUICHE_BUG_IF(Moqt_full_track_name_too_large_01, !IsValid())
<< "Constructing a Full Track Name that is too large.";
}
FullTrackName::FullTrackName(TrackNamespace ns, absl::string_view name)
: namespace_(ns), name_(name) {
QUICHE_BUG_IF(Moqt_full_track_name_too_large_02, !IsValid())
<< "Constructing a Full Track Name that is too large.";
}
std::string FullTrackName::ToString() const {
return absl::StrCat(namespace_.ToString(), "::", name_);
}
void FullTrackName::set_name(absl::string_view name) {
QUICHE_BUG_IF(Moqt_name_too_large_03, !CanAddName(name))
<< "Setting a name that is too large.";
name_ = name;
}
} // namespace moqt
